Output 6a31098ca7e0f764a36ea68f7dbe52223febf19d7838b54b9ada5263230048ce:12

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 320d3fd2ece059890ea4e29812873fda3d514a2f
address
bc1qxgxnl5hvupvcjr4yu2vp9pelmg74zj307wyf2e
transaction
6a31098ca7e0f764a36ea68f7dbe52223febf19d7838b54b9ada5263230048ce
spent
true